Choosing the Right Camshaft for Your Ford Inline Six​


The camshaft is the single most important decision in building a performance Ford inline six engine. Choose wrong and no other modification will save you. An improper cam produces an engine that either stumbles, stalls, and annoys you in traffic — or one that feels dead below 4,000 RPM and gets beaten by things that have no business beating it.
